Potential Proxy Execution via Sysctl

Source
github.com/elastic/protections-artifacts

This rule detects the execution of a command or binary through the Sysctl binary. Attackers may use this technique to execute commands while attempting to evade detection.

Rule body

[rule]
description = """
This rule detects the execution of a command or binary through the Sysctl binary. Attackers may use this technique to
execute commands while attempting to evade detection.
"""
id = "268ffea4-fc13-4ab5-a473-07d10255ea8d"
license = "Elastic License v2"
name = "Potential Proxy Execution via Sysctl"
os_list = ["linux"]
reference = ["https://gtfobins.github.io/gtfobins/sysctl/"]
version = "1.0.3"

query = '''
process where event.type == "start" and event.action == "exec" and process.name == "sysctl" and
process.args : "kernel.core_pattern=*/bin/*sh*-c*"
'''

min_endpoint_version = "7.15.0"
optional_actions = []
[[actions]]
action = "kill_process"
field = "process.entity_id"
state = 0

[[actions]]
action = "kill_process"
field = "process.parent.entity_id"
state = 0

[[threat]]
framework = "MITRE ATT&CK"
[[threat.technique]]
id = "T1059"
name = "Command and Scripting Interpreter"
reference = "https://attack.mitre.org/techniques/T1059/"
[[threat.technique.subtechnique]]
id = "T1059.004"
name = "Unix Shell"
reference = "https://attack.mitre.org/techniques/T1059/004/"



[threat.tactic]
id = "TA0002"
name = "Execution"
reference = "https://attack.mitre.org/tactics/TA0002/"
[[threat]]
framework = "MITRE ATT&CK"
[[threat.technique]]
id = "T1218"
name = "System Binary Proxy Execution"
reference = "https://attack.mitre.org/techniques/T1218/"


[threat.tactic]
id = "TA0005"
name = "Defense Evasion"
reference = "https://attack.mitre.org/tactics/TA0005/"

[internal]
min_endpoint_version = "7.15.0"
